    Abstract: An optical pickup device, an optical disc device, and a prism are provided to reduce the thickness of the entire optical path by narrowing a light flux vertical width of an optical beam to be narrower than the last light flux diameter although a light source in which an emission angle of the optical beam is broad in an upper and lower direction is used. An LD(Laser Diode)(21) emits an optical beam whose emission angle is broad in an upper and lower direction vertical to an information recording surface of an optical disc and is narrow in a horizontal direction. A collimator lens(22) converts the optical beam emitted from the LD(21) into a collimating beam. An objective lens(29) condenses the optical beam on the optical disc. An extending part extends a light flux horizontal width, which is a width of a direction horizontal to the information recording surface of the optical disc of the optical beam converted into the collimating beam by the collimator lens(22), to the last light flux diameter which is a diameter of the optical beam when the optical beam is inputted to the objective lens(29). A prism extends a light flux vertical width, which is a width of a direction vertical to the information recording surface of the optical disc of the extended optical beam, to the last light flux diameter, and simultaneously emits the optical beam to the objective lens(29). The collimator lens(22) converts the optical beam into the collimating beam so that the light flux vertical width and the light flux horizontal width in the optical beam are narrower than the last light flux diameter.

    Abstract: An optical pickup device which assures interchangeability between plural types of optical discs (2a, 2b) with different layered structures, such as CD, CD-R or DVD, which is reduced in size and which realizes reproduction of high reliability information signals. The pickup device includes a light source (3, 4) for radiating laser light beams of different wavelengths in association with the plural types of the optical discs (2a, 2b) with different layered structures, an objective lens (5a, 5b) for converging the laser light beam radiated form the light source on the signal recording layer of the optical disc (2a, 2b), an objective lens switching mechanism (14) for switching and moving the objective lens (5a, 5b) to the recording/reproducing position, light splitting means (44; 77) for splitting the incident laser light beam from the light source from the reflected laserlight beam reflected from the optical disc, plural photodetectors (6, 4) for receiving the reflected laser light split by the light splitting means, and an optical system correction means (16) for correcting the objective lens.
